At runtime, Open Client/Server applications pick up localization information from external files. Two directories in the Sybase release directory contain these files:
The locales directory contains:
The message subdirectory, which contains localized error messages for all products, organized by language name.
The locales file, which maps locale names to languages, character sets, and collating sequences.
The global object identifiers file, which maps global names for objects such as character sets and languages to local platform-specific names.
The charsets directory contains:
A subdirectory for each supported character set. Each subdirectory contains sort and conversion files for the character set.
The mnemonics file, which provides mnemonic strings for replacing source Unicode, if necessary.
All Open Client/Server products include files to support at least one language and one or more character sets and collating sequences.
During installation, these files are loaded into the Sybase release directory structure in the correct locations.
The installation process automatically loads any additional
Open Client/Server Language Module for connectivity into
the Sybase release directory in the correct locations.